Wedding Dress Styles, Shapes & Silhouettes

Confused about what style of wedding dress to wear? Does wedding dress terminology confuse you? In this video, I’m breaking down all the different names, titles, and silhouettes you need to know about when dress shopping. Highly recommend trying everything on so you can identify what you feel…
